Top Options Compared for review biodegradable laminated box finishes

The Riverbend PLA-based gloss, Savannah’s Swiss-coated matte film, and Westport’s hybrid water-based option all answer different review biodegradable laminated box finishes questions on my commitment list. Riverbend’s gloss shows 72 dynes per centimeter on the Elgin lab Dyne pen before we dial in rotary laminator pressure. Savannah’s matte rests at 58 dynes and demands a corona pass on the Savannah line to make the water-based adhesive cling to recycled 350gsm C1S board, while Westport’s hybrid checks in at 64 dynes with built-in primers that bond to 100% recycled fluting without extra treatment.

Surface-temperature tolerance matters. Riverbend’s gloss stays stable up to 220 degrees Fahrenheit, so we could stack five laminated sheets overnight without the gloss “pulling” the next day. Savannah’s matte remains firm to 195 degrees, letting the Southside next-day assembly line run with minimal curling, and Westport’s hybrid tops out at 205 degrees while adding a softer modulus that feels warm to the touch during hand assembly in the Savannah finishing room. Adhesion testing on recycled paperboard delivers 4.6 pounds per inch for Riverbend gloss, 4.1 for Savannah matte, and a solid 4.8 for Westport hybrid after 48 hours in an 85% RH chamber monitored in our Atlanta humidity suite.

Usability holds equal weight. Riverbend’s gloss starts curing in three seconds on our rotaries, but the PLA layer needs extra chill time, so we keep the reusable chill drums spinning at 18 RPM. Savannah’s matte cures slightly faster, but only after a second corona pass at Riverbend since the water-based adhesive beads without that treatment. Westport’s hybrid handles a single pass, although the slower feed prevents tension wrinkles; it suits brands that can accept a 1.2-second longer dwell on the Custom Logo Things laminator. When the review biodegradable laminated box finishes criteria—shine, adhesion, compostability at ASTM D6400 or EN 13432, and operational ease—becomes a checklist, the data guides the right match while keeping Riverbend, Savannah, and Westport crews aligned.

Riverbend PLA Gloss Laminates

Riverbend’s PLA gloss starts with a 45-micron PLA layer bonded to a 20-micron paper release liner, giving it the clarity and 1.6 gloss units premium skincare lines demand. The finish carries ASTM D6400 compostability, and our Savannah QC field tests showed no adhesive migration after five handling cycles. The tactile feedback stays smooth without slipping thanks to a matte corona finish on the underside, and the gloss runs through rotary laminators once we pair it with a 50 gsm water-based adhesive that cures in six seconds at 210 degrees. Laminating to 350 gsm C1S artboard required a 12 PSI increase in nip pressure, a setup change Carlson Street operators now flag on the checklist.

The gloss also survived the East Port pallet drop test: twenty finished boxes dropped from 18 inches and still retained edge clarity, with no PET fibers detected after scanning scrap with the spectrometer borrowed from Georgia Tech labs. The adhesive rail at Riverbend now reads “PLA – 50gsm,” so crews know exactly what parameters to dial in whenever review biodegradable laminated box finishes demand a high-glare presence.

Savannah Matte Water-Based Coatings

Savannah’s matte coating uses Swiss lamination and micro-embossed texture to keep fingerprint resistance even when shoppers touch samples on the floor. Optical lab haze sits below 1.2%, and the finish survives the Die-Mart iQ-4500 die-cutter at 1,200 sheets per hour without micro-abrasion. A modified water-based adhesive bonds at 150 gsm to recycled paperboard, maintains adhesion in the humidity chamber at 92% RH for 72 hours, and resists scuffing even after four pallet shifts tracked by the Riverbend warehouse team.

Westport Hybrid Soft-Touch Film

Westport’s hybrid soft-touch film brings warmth with a low-modulus silicone layer, and our Riverbend die-cutters favor it for tactile goods. Modulus tests show 1,200 psi, giving a slight “give” similar to latex coating, and the finish survives six consecutive hand assembly stations at Savannah. The film takes 1.5 seconds longer to cure than Savannah matte, but the extra window lets press operators skip a second adhesive reapplication. Field tests across Riverbend and Westport finishing lines also show boxes only need 4.5 mm of head space to avoid compression marks when stacked.

The softness shifts expectations for review biodegradable laminated box finishes—once we dialed unwind tension to 22 N, the hybrid fed through folder-gluers without tearing, and the tactile warmth earned praise from the brand’s experiential marketing lead during a Carlson Street showroom walkthrough. Price Comparison of Biodegradable Laminated Box Finishes

Breaking down costs per square foot helps clients see how review biodegradable laminated box finishes stack up. At Southside, including film, adhesive, and labor, Riverbend’s PLA gloss hits $0.18 per square foot for 5,000-piece orders, dropping to $0.14 with 50,000-piece runs once chill drums and release liners are amortized. Savannah’s matte film sits at $0.17 per square foot for a 3,000-piece batch, but the water-based adhesive and faster curing mean total labor falls to $0.15 at scale. Westport’s hybrid soft-touch costs $0.22 for small runs because of higher film content, yet it saves about 22 seconds per box on lamination, cutting labor for intricate hand-assembled cartons destined for Seattle and Denver.

Finish Per-Sq-Ft Film Cost Adhesive/Labor Impact Volume Threshold Notes
Riverbend PLA Gloss $0.11 Requires chill drums, +$0.07 labor at small runs 50,000+ pieces High gloss, certified ASTM D6400, needs 12 PSI more nip force
Savannah Matte Water-Based $0.10 Corona treatment necessary, -$0.02 labor at scale 30,000+ pieces Matte that resists fingerprints, haze <1.2%, 150 gsm adhesive
Westport Hybrid Soft-Touch $0.14 Slower unwind saves 22 seconds per box 20,000+ pieces Warm hand feel, modulus 1,200 psi, matches compostable claims

Process and Timeline for Biodegradable Laminated Box Finishes

The end-to-end workflow for review biodegradable laminated box finishes starts in the board conditioning room, where we stabilize substrates at 45% relative humidity for 12 hours before they hit the laminator. We follow with a gentle corona treatment that bumps surface energy to about 62 dynes per centimeter so PLA or water-based adhesives spread without gaps. The board then runs through the rotary laminator at 180-210 degrees Fahrenheit—much gentler than the 230-degree peak solvent films need—to keep the biodegradable film from softening or losing gloss. After lamination, boards cool on reusable chill drums for four minutes, then pass through the Geiger Tester to ensure adhesion clears the 4.5-pound standard for humid climates.

A realistic timeline covers two days for sample development, during which we run all three finishes and lock in the adhesive setup preferred by engineering. In-house testing—including humidity chamber work at 90% RH and ISTA vibration protocols—takes another day. Production starts on day four, with die-cutting, folding, and gluing over three to five business days depending on complexity; add another day whenever a custom die or elaborate folding style forces the finishing room to retool.

Potential bottlenecks still pop up. Drying ovens clog if we rush a Savannah matte run, and delayed recycler pickups for scrap boards can push release out 48 hours unless we rebook early. My tip for brands is to pre-qualify the adhesive during the design phase so the team isn’t waiting on lab approvals mid-production. Another trick: store samples of each finish onsite so any finishing operator can test folding, stacking, or gluing without stopping the line; that habit already saved us a full shift on approvals.

How to Choose Biodegradable Laminated Box Finishes

Choosing between review biodegradable laminated box finishes depends on brand positioning, tactile goals, shelf life, and regulatory needs. For premium goods needing reflective presence and sparkly highlights, Riverbend PLA gloss dominates because it protects biosourced substrates while supporting ASTM D6400 or EN 13432 claims. When matte elegance with fingerprint resistance is the goal, Savannah’s water-based coating fits thanks to sub-1.2% haze levels and stackability in humid warehouses. Brands seeking warmth should lean on Westport’s hybrid soft-touch film; the padding stays compostable and survives die-cutting, folding, and gluing without cracking, and the finish ships reliably to humid ports like Houston and Miami.

Check supplier transparency by asking for detailed certificates, chain-of-custody documentation, and adhesive MSDS; that exposes forced warranties or films hiding PET layers. Run pilot batches on your local laminator before committing to full production, and bring those pilot sheets through your fold-and-glue cells so engineers can spot stress lines or curling. Coordinate decision-making with engineers, brand managers, and sustainability leads so the finish handles your finishing operations and reinforces your positioning.

Storage and logistics should factor in as well: if the product ships to climates with drastic temperature swings, pick a finish whose adhesive resists micro-fractures after repeated handling. Our QC team swears by a corona pass on low-energy substrates; skipping that step risks good review biodegradable laminated box finishes failing due to poor adhesion.
